# =============================================================================
|
||
# fetch.py — сборка лёгких бинарников NikoVPN (замена fetch.sh)
|
||
#
|
||
# uv run fetch.py [--jobs N] [--only имя,...]
|
||
#
|
||
# sing-box v1.13.19 собирается из исходников slim-патчем:
|
||
# остаются только outbounds: vless (+utls, без reality), hysteria,
|
||
# hysteria2, tuic, naive; inbounds: tproxy/mixed/socks/http/direct;
|
||
# выпилены: vmess, trojan, shadowsocks, tor, ssh, shadowtls, anytls,
|
||
# tun, ssmapi; теги без gvisor/wireguard/clash_api/acme/dhcp/tailscale.
|
||
# Результат: gz ~14MB вместо ~23MB (с naive), ~9MB (без).
|
||
#
|
||
# naive (cronet) собирается через прекомпилированные libcronet.a
|
||
# (github.com/sagernet/cronet-go/lib/*_musl) + system clang/lld +
|
||
# musl.cc sysroot. Архитектуры без cronet-библиотек собираются
|
||
# CGO_ENABLED=0 без naive (установщик сам пропустит этот протокол).
|
||
#
|
||
# ipt2socks не пересобирается — готовые .gz в bin/ сохраняются.
|
||
# =============================================================================
